The Sónar Music Festival of advanced music and multimedia art wrapped up its Chicago edition this weekend, filling the famous Millennium Park with concerts, projections and art. Festival organisers are very satisfied with the outcome in Chicago and are now planning editions in cities like London and Tokyo.
The first edition of Sónar Chicago kicked off yesterday with an inaugural show at the Jay Pritzker Pavilion in Chicago’s famous Millennium Park. Musicians Jimmy Edgar, The Slew, Kid Koala, Bradien and Faraón opened the 3-day festival with their much-anticipated performances. The festival will continue on Friday and Saturday in the Chicago Cultural Center where the up-and-coming Catalan artist bRUNA will play on Saturday.
The Barcelona World Music Festival will kick off the first week of October, bringing a wide offer of renowned music to the city. The festival will feature African music this year, showcasing artists such as Victor Demé, Nino Galissa, Bino Barros, Lokua Kanza and Don Bigg.
The famous Barcelona jazz venue Jamboree commemorated its 50th anniversary last night as part of the Mas i Mas Festival. The musical event took place in the city centre’s Plaça Reial, where local jazz musicians captivated crowds.

The Italian pyrotechnic Santa Chiara has opened the 40th edition of the International Costa Brava Fireworks Festival that lasts 6 days. Thousands of people have watched the spectacle.
During the first edition of the Cruïlla Festival celebrated at Barcelona?s Forum, 16,000 people gathered to listen to great figures of the international and national music scene, such as Ben Harper, Alpha Blondy and the legendary band The Wailers.

The 2010 edition of Barcelona?s festival of ?advanced? music and multimedia art, Sónar, has been a huge success. A quality programme, combining big names with new bands, has congregated 84,000 people for a three-day dance party.
